Eric Larson, "The Devil in the White City"

Eric Larson, "The Devil in the White City"

Eric Larson, whose books are always read in one breath and leave a deep imprint in the soul, knows how, like no one else, to revive the pictures of the past or draw the world he created himself. "The Devil in the White City", a thriller based on real events, the main character of which is Dr. Holmes, captures from the very first lines. Holmes is the pseudonym taken by the killer, and his real name is Herman Webster Mudgett. The nickname he later received was Doctor of Torture

Lermontov, "Princess Ligovskaya": the history of creation and a summary of the novel

Lermontov, "Princess Ligovskaya": the history of creation and a summary of the novel

"Princess Ligovskaya" by Lermontov is an unfinished socio-psychological novel with elements of a secular story. Work on it was started by the author in 1836. It reflected the personal experiences of the writer. However, already in 1837 Lermontov abandoned him. Some of the ideas and ideas that appeared on the pages of this work were later used in the "Hero of Our Time"

Famous French historian Fernand Braudel: biography, best books and interesting facts

Famous French historian Fernand Braudel: biography, best books and interesting facts

Fernand Braudel is one of the most famous French historians. His idea to take into account geographical and economic facts in understanding historical processes revolutionized science. Most of all, Braudel was interested in the emergence of the capitalist system. Also, the scientist was a member of the historiographic school "Annals", which was engaged in the study of historical phenomena in the social sciences

Diderot Denis: biography, philosophy

Diderot Denis: biography, philosophy

Denis Diderot is an intellectual of his time, a French writer and philosopher. He is best known for his encyclopedia, which he completed in 1751. Along with Montesquieu, Voltaire and Rousseau, he was considered one of the ideologists of the third estate in France, a popularizer of the ideas of the Enlightenment, which, it is believed, paved the way for the French Revolution of 1789
